Python para Iniciantes: Aprenda a Programar com Facilidade
Por que aprender Python para iniciantes é uma ótima escolha? Neste artigo, exploramos algumas razões pelas quais aprender Python pode ser vantajoso para quem está começando na programação. Além da sintaxe simples e legível, Python oferece uma ampla gama de aplicações e conta com uma comunidade ativa e recursos online. Também apresentamos conceitos básicos e exemplos práticos de como programar em Python. Confira nossas dicas e recursos para facilitar seu aprendizado!
Navegue pelo conteúdo
Por que aprender Python para iniciantes é uma ótima escolha?
Introdução
Python é uma linguagem de programação versátil e poderosa que tem ganhado cada vez mais popularidade entre iniciantes na área de programação. Existem diversas razões pelas quais aprender Python pode ser uma ótima escolha para quem está começando nesse universo. Neste artigo, vamos explorar algumas dessas razões e entender por que Python é uma linguagem tão recomendada para iniciantes.
Vantagens de aprender Python
Sintaxe simples e legível
Uma das principais vantagens de aprender Python como seu primeiro idioma de programação é a sua sintaxe simples e legível. Diferente de outras linguagens de programação, Python possui uma sintaxe que se aproxima muito do inglês, o que facilita a compreensão e o aprendizado para quem está começando. Essa característica torna Python uma ótima escolha para quem está dando os primeiros passos na programação.
Ampla gama de aplicações
Além disso, Python é uma linguagem que oferece uma ampla gama de aplicações. Com Python, é possível desenvolver desde simples scripts até aplicações web complexas, passando por análise de dados, inteligência artificial, automação de tarefas e muito mais. A versatilidade de Python permite que os iniciantes explorem diferentes áreas e encontrem aquela que mais desperta seu interesse.
Comunidade ativa e colaborativa
Outro ponto importante é a comunidade ativa e colaborativa que envolve a linguagem Python. Existem inúmeros fóruns, grupos de estudo e tutoriais disponíveis online, nos quais os iniciantes podem encontrar suporte e compartilhar conhecimentos. Além disso, a vasta quantidade de bibliotecas e frameworks disponíveis para Python facilita o desenvolvimento de projetos e acelera o aprendizado.
Principais conceitos de programação para iniciantes em Python
Ao iniciar o aprendizado de programação em Python, é fundamental entender alguns conceitos básicos que são essenciais para o desenvolvimento de habilidades sólidas na linguagem. Aqui estão alguns dos principais conceitos que todo iniciante em Python deve conhecer:
Variáveis
Em Python, as variáveis são utilizadas para armazenar valores que podem ser utilizados posteriormente no programa. É importante entender como declarar, atribuir valores e manipular variáveis em Python.
Estruturas de Controle
As estruturas de controle são utilizadas para controlar o fluxo de execução de um programa. Em Python, as estruturas de controle mais comuns são: condicionais (if, else, elif), loops (for, while) e estruturas de repetição (break, continue).
Listas e Tuplas
Listas e tuplas são estruturas de dados utilizadas para armazenar coleções de elementos em Python. Elas permitem o armazenamento de diferentes tipos de dados e possuem métodos que facilitam a manipulação dos elementos.
Funções
As funções são blocos de código que executam uma tarefa específica. Elas permitem a reutilização de código e a organização do programa em blocos lógicos. É importante entender como criar e chamar funções em Python.
Dicas e recursos para aprender a programar com facilidade em Python
Aprender a programar pode parecer intimidante no início, mas com as dicas certas e os recursos adequados, é possível tornar esse processo mais fácil e agradável. Aqui estão algumas dicas e recursos que podem te ajudar a aprender a programar com facilidade em Python:
Pratique regularmente
A programação é uma habilidade que se desenvolve com a prática. Reserve um tempo regularmente para programar em Python, resolvendo exercícios e desenvolvendo pequenos projetos. Quanto mais você praticar, mais rápido irá progredir.
Utilize recursos online
Existem diversas plataformas online que oferecem cursos e tutoriais gratuitos para aprender Python. Alguns exemplos são o Codecademy, Coursera e Udemy. Esses recursos oferecem uma estrutura de aprendizado passo a passo, facilitando o processo de aprendizagem.
Participe de comunidades
Junte-se a grupos de estudo, fóruns e comunidades online voltadas para Python. Compartilhe suas dúvidas, participe de discussões e aproveite o conhecimento coletivo dessas comunidades. A troca de experiências pode ser muito enriquecedora.
Desafie-se com projetos práticos
Uma excelente maneira de consolidar o aprendizado em Python é desenvolvendo projetos práticos. Crie pequenos programas, automatize tarefas do seu dia a dia ou desenvolva uma aplicação simples. Colocar o conhecimento em prática ajuda a fixar os conceitos e a desenvolver habilidades de resolução de problemas.
Exemplos práticos de como programar em Python para iniciantes
A melhor forma de aprender a programar em Python é através da prática. Por isso, vamos apresentar alguns exemplos práticos de como programar em Python para iniciantes. Lembre-se de que a prática é fundamental para o aprendizado, então não se limite aos exemplos apresentados aqui. Experimente, teste e crie seus próprios programas!
-
Programa de cálculo de média
Crie um programa que solicite ao usuário três notas e calcule a média aritmética entre elas. O programa deve exibir a média calculada.
-
Jogo da adivinhação
Desenvolva um programa em que o computador escolha um número aleatório entre 1 e 100, e o usuário deve tentar adivinhar qual é esse número. O programa deve fornecer dicas ao usuário, indicando se o número é maior ou menor do que o chute feito.
-
Conversor de moedas
Crie um programa que converta um valor em real para dólar. O programa deve solicitar ao usuário o valor em real e exibir o valor equivalente em dólar, considerando uma taxa de conversão fixa.
Esses são apenas alguns exemplos de como programar em Python para iniciantes. A medida que você avança no aprendizado, é possível explorar conceitos mais avançados e desenvolver projetos mais complexos. O importante é manter a prática constante e a curiosidade para continuar aprendendo.
Com essas dicas, conceitos básicos e exemplos práticos, você está pronto para iniciar sua jornada de aprendizado em Python. Lembre-se de que o mais importante é persistir, praticar e buscar sempre novos desafios. Com dedicação e esforço, você será capaz de dominar a linguagem Python e se tornar um programador habilidoso. Aproveite a jornada e bons estudos!
Dicas e recursos para aprender a programar com facilidade em Python
Aprender a programar em Python pode ser uma experiência emocionante e gratificante. No entanto, como qualquer nova habilidade, pode haver desafios ao longo do caminho. Felizmente, existem várias dicas e recursos disponíveis que podem ajudar você a aprender a programar com facilidade em Python. Aqui estão algumas sugestões que podem ser úteis:
Comece com conceitos básicos
Antes de mergulhar em projetos complexos, é essencial compreender os conceitos básicos de programação em Python. Familiarize-se com a sintaxe, variáveis, estruturas de controle e funções. Existem muitos recursos online, como tutoriais em vídeo e cursos interativos, que podem ajudar você a aprender esses fundamentos.
Pratique com exercícios
A prática é a chave para aperfeiçoar suas habilidades de programação. Procure por exercícios práticos e desafios de programação em Python. Eles ajudarão você a aplicar o conhecimento teórico e a desenvolver sua lógica de programação. Sites como o HackerRank e o Project Euler oferecem uma variedade de exercícios para programadores de todos os níveis.
Utilize recursos online
A internet é uma fonte inesgotável de recursos para aprender Python. Existem blogs, fóruns e comunidades online dedicadas a discutir e compartilhar conhecimentos sobre programação em Python. Participe dessas comunidades, faça perguntas e compartilhe suas experiências. Isso não apenas ajudará você a aprender, mas também a se conectar com outros programadores.
Faça projetos práticos
Uma maneira eficaz de aprimorar suas habilidades em Python é trabalhar em projetos práticos. Identifique uma área de interesse, como desenvolvimento web, análise de dados ou automação de tarefas, e desenvolva um projeto relacionado a ela. Isso permitirá que você aplique seus conhecimentos em um contexto real e ganhe experiência prática.
Explore bibliotecas e frameworks
Python é conhecido por sua vasta coleção de bibliotecas e frameworks. Essas ferramentas oferecem funcionalidades pré-criadas que podem agilizar o desenvolvimento de projetos. Pesquise e familiarize-se com bibliotecas populares, como NumPy para computação científica, Django para desenvolvimento web e Pandas para análise de dados. Aprender a utilizar essas bibliotecas pode ampliar suas possibilidades como programador Python.
Exemplos práticos de como programar em Python para iniciantes
A melhor maneira de aprender a programar em Python é por meio de exemplos práticos. Aqui estão alguns exemplos simples de programas em Python que podem ajudar iniciantes a compreender melhor a linguagem:
-
Calculadora
Crie um programa que permita ao usuário realizar operações matemáticas básicas, como adição, subtração, multiplicação e divisão. O programa deve solicitar ao usuário os números e a operação desejada, em seguida, exibir o resultado.
-
Verificador de palíndromo
Desenvolva um programa que verifique se uma palavra ou frase é um palíndromo. Um palíndromo é uma palavra ou frase que pode ser lida da mesma maneira tanto da esquerda para a direita quanto da direita para a esquerda. O programa deve solicitar ao usuário a palavra ou frase e exibir se é um palíndromo ou não.
-
Gerador de senha
Crie um programa que gere uma senha aleatória com base nos critérios definidos pelo usuário, como o comprimento da senha e os caracteres permitidos. O programa deve exibir a senha gerada.
-
Jogo da forca
Desenvolva um programa que permita ao usuário jogar o clássico jogo da forca. O programa deve selecionar aleatoriamente uma palavra e exibir os espaços em branco para as letras desconhecidas. O usuário deve tentar adivinhar as letras corretas até adivinhar a palavra completa ou até que o número máximo de tentativas seja alcançado.
Esses são apenas alguns exemplos de como programar em Python para iniciantes. À medida que você ganha mais experiência, pode explorar projetos mais complexos e desafiadores. Lembre-se de que a prática constante e a busca por novos desafios são essenciais para aprimorar suas habilidades de programação em Python. Divirta-se programando e continue aprendendo!
A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
